Understanding Cassis: Origins and Production
Cassis, more specifically Crème de Cassis, is a liqueur intrinsically linked to the Bourgogne region of France. Its production is deeply rooted in the terroir, relying on specific blackcurrant varieties cultivated in the rich soils of the Dijon area. This meticulous process transforms these humble berries into the dark, luscious liqueur we know and love. The key to understanding Cassis lies in appreciating its origins and the traditional methods employed in its creation.
- Cassis is traditionally made from blackcurrants grown in the Dijon area of Burgundy. The specific microclimate and soil conditions of this area contribute significantly to the unique flavor profile of the blackcurrants.
- The production involves maceration and fermentation of the blackcurrants. This process carefully extracts the color, aroma, and flavor compounds from the berries.
- Sugar and alcohol are added to create the final product. The precise balance of these ingredients contributes to the liqueur's characteristic sweetness and tartness.
- Aging contributes to the complexity of the flavor. While not all Cassis is aged, some producers allow the liqueur to mature, adding layers of complexity to its taste. The aging process softens the tartness and allows the flavors to meld.
The Distinctive Flavor Profile of Cassis Blackcurrant
The taste of Cassis is captivatingly complex, a harmonious blend of sweetness and tartness that defines its unique character. It's more than just blackcurrant flavor; it's an experience. Understanding its flavor profile allows you to appreciate its versatility in various culinary applications.
- Intensely fruity aroma: The first impression is often an explosion of ripe blackcurrant, a powerful and inviting scent.
- Sweet yet tart taste: This balance is key to Cassis' appeal. The sweetness is balanced by a refreshing tartness that prevents it from being cloying.
- Notes of blackcurrant, often with hints of spice and earthiness: Depending on the brand and production methods, you might detect subtle hints of spice, vanilla, or even an earthy undertone.
- Variability in flavor depending on the production method and age: Just like fine wine, the nuances of Cassis can vary based on the blackcurrant variety, the production process, and the aging period.
Culinary Applications of Cassis Blackcurrant
Cassis is far from a one-trick pony. Its intense flavor profile lends itself to a remarkable range of culinary applications, extending beyond its classic cocktail pairings. Let's explore the versatile nature of this delightful liqueur.
- Classic cocktail: Kir Royale (Cassis and Champagne). This elegant and refreshing cocktail is arguably the most famous Cassis-based drink.
- Other cocktails: Cassis provides a deep, fruity base for countless variations on margaritas, mojitos, and other popular cocktails. Experiment with different mixers and garnishes to create unique concoctions.
- Dessert applications: Cassis sorbets, mousses, and sauces add a sophisticated touch to desserts, perfectly complementing chocolate, fruit tarts, and ice creams.
- Savory uses: A Cassis reduction can be a surprising yet delightful addition to meat dishes, especially game. Its tartness cuts through richness and enhances the flavor of the meat.
Popular Cassis Cocktails
Let's delve into the recipes for two iconic Cassis cocktails:
Kir Royale:
- 1 part Crème de Cassis
- 4 parts Champagne (or other sparkling wine)
- Garnish: Fresh blackcurrant or raspberry
Instructions: Pour the Crème de Cassis into a chilled champagne flute. Top with Champagne and gently stir. Garnish and enjoy!
Cassis Mojito:
- 2 oz White Rum
- 1 oz Crème de Cassis
- 1 oz Lime Juice
- 8-10 Mint Leaves
- 1/2 oz Simple Syrup
- Club Soda
- Garnish: Mint sprig and lime wedge
Instructions: Muddle mint leaves with simple syrup in a shaker. Add rum, Cassis, lime juice, and ice. Shake well. Strain into a highball glass filled with ice. Top with club soda. Garnish and enjoy!
Selecting and Storing Cassis Blackcurrant
Choosing and storing your Cassis properly is crucial for ensuring you get the best flavor experience. Here's how to select and maintain the quality of this exquisite liqueur.
- Look for reputable brands: Opt for well-established brands known for their quality and commitment to traditional production methods.
- Check the bottle for any signs of damage: Ensure the bottle is undamaged and sealed properly to prevent spoilage.
- Store in a cool, dark place: Avoid exposing the Cassis to direct sunlight or excessive heat.
- Once opened, refrigerate to maintain quality: Refrigeration slows down the oxidation process and helps preserve the flavor.
